A Postgraduate Certificate in Chinese Calligraphy for Rewards offers a deep dive into the art of Chinese calligraphy, focusing on both traditional techniques and contemporary applications. Students will develop a refined understanding of brushwork, ink control, and character structure, crucial elements for mastery in this ancient art form.
Learning outcomes include proficiency in various calligraphy styles, a critical appreciation of calligraphy's historical and cultural significance, and the ability to create original calligraphic works. Students will also hone their artistic expression and develop a personal calligraphic voice, suitable for both personal enjoyment and professional pursuits.
